On Oct 7, 2009, at 6:44 PM, peter edwards wrote:
> -Where do you order boards from? I'm planning on using expressPCB
> and ordering boards 50 or 100 at a time.
I've been really happy with pcbcart so far, as I've mentioned before.
I picked them based on the fact that they'd take Eagle files straight
up, and incidentally they've turned out to be pretty good.

I've come to accept doing revisions as a fact of life.
With pcbcart, you can change the silkscreen of an old order at no
additional tooling cost as long as the holes/pads/traces/etc. stay the
same.
